My work pertains to the figure/individual, as it relates to the surrounding environments and material culture which support and sustain it. I am interested in the delicate, the quiet and the susceptiblenature of this person/individual/figure, and further in its relationship with the vivid, robust and long-lasting materials, objects and environments which surround it.
I am exploring a notion of the 'person' as a variable - an impressionable dependent upon that which surrounds it. In this notion, we, humans, are delicate and susceptible, we are but whispers upon that which withstands and outlives us. We are overpowered by the vivid solidity and comparative sense of permanence in the structural objects, materials and culture around us. Our changeability and sensitivity to our surroundings puts us in a vulnerable, delicate position. Currently, I am exploring this delicate/powerful relationship through paintings of unstaged photographed figures interacting with their everyday surroundings. These figures are explored as transparent, blank beings amongst vibrant, vivid material surroundings.
